Sen. Sherrod Brown (D-Ohio) called for an expansion of the Earned Income Tax Credit (EITC), saying it would strengthen the middle class and grow the economy.

“Enhancing the Earned Income Tax Credit should be a bipartisan goal,” Brown said Friday. “The president’s call for action is the first step toward ensuring that Americans who work hard and take responsibility can take home more of their pay each month.”

Brown has introduced the Working Families Tax Relief Act, which would expand eligibility of the maximum EITC to childless full-time workers and allow people between the ages of 21-24 to receive the tax credit.
